Sam Jury. Forever is Never - video projection at the Louise Blouin Institute, London, 2008.
Description:
A short looped video constructed from hundreds of still images; these being the discarded stages of making a photographically constructed 'hybrid' head via digital means. Constructed like a stop frame animation, 'Forever is Never' continually oscillates between the futuristic, almost science fiction, to Vermeer like painterly images, with several stages in between. The resultant moving image depicts a virtual portrait perpetually in flux that continually flickers and pulses through states of change to a rhythm akin to breathing.
